As a Supermarket Assistant, you'll help our difference be felt by our customers on every visit, providing the Partner-led service and passion for food that our competitors can't compete with - passionate Partners serving food lovers!

Your drive to go the extra mile will make all the difference to the impression our customers have about the Waitrose brand and keep them returning again and again by earning their trust and loyalty for a lifetime.

In addition to your contractual pay, any time worked between 22:00 - 06:00 will attract Night Premium at a rate of £3.75 per hour. This will also apply to existing Partners who have enrolled onto Enhanced Hours Premium arrangements.

Due to working time regulations, applicants must be 18 years or over to apply.

Key Responsibilities

  • Stock replenishment - ensuring our shelves remain as full as possible and products are in the right place at the right time for our customers.
  • Fulfilling online customer orders ready for our drivers to deliver their shopping direct to their doors.
  • Reducing wastage by following product due diligence and markdowns to those reaching their sell by dates.
  • Working with the wider shop team to support when needed including; checkout support, managing Click & Collect orders, fulfilling on-demand customer orders and more.
  • Maintain a safe and tidy working environment with general shopkeeping tasks.

Pay: £13.00 (£13.25 After 90 days)

Contract Type: Temporary

Hours of Work: Part time work, 12 hours per week. To include early starts, late finishes, evenings and weekends between the hours of 06:30 - 23:30.

Job Level: Partnership Level 10

Where You'll Be Working: Lymington (Waitrose & Partners), Stanford Road, Lymington, Hampshire, SO41 9GF
